General Comments
Spelling and punctuation are better, now. Because of this, the theme statements automatically appear more mature. However, some individuals are still not following the proper format
for a theme statement. If you lost your "How to Write a Theme Statement" sheet, go onto my website and download or print a copy at home. Remember, I give you handouts carefully
designed to help you think and learn. Keep track of them! Finally, for those of you making a score of "2," it is often because your topic (a single word that is an abstract noun) doens't
match your statement about the human condition OR you are not narrowing down your topic into a single word. (Maybe both.)
